Major problems of Nepalese Agriculture
1) Land fragmentation
- Small parcel of land scattered at different places.
- Difficult to manage modern technology.
2) Poor infrastructure development
- Lack of irrigation, rural roads, electricity, cold storage, market and rural agro-based industries.
3) Lower investment in farming
- Poor farmer
- Difficult to get credit for poor farmer
4) Decline farm profitability
- High input cost
- Labor migration from rural area to urban area and other country.
- Yield stagnation.
- Lower price of farmer production
5) Environmental degradation
- Decline soil fertility.
- Soil erosion
- Flood and natural calamities.
